S6:E7 - Building better health with "LISS" 09.01.2023

- LISS = Low Intensity Steady-State [cardio] is easily overlooked when it comes to our health-span longevity One way to get LISS is through some good ole WALKING Studies have shown that 30 minutes of daily walking can decrease one’s likelihood of heart disease & stroke by 35%! S5:E7 - A better way to create longevity & durability: Movement pattern training splits 05.09.2022

- After 4 years of training, I now realize that we don’t train “muscle groups” (i.e. biceps, triceps, chest, back, etc.) . However… . We should train MOVEMENT PATTERNS [rather than muscle groups] . There are 7 common movement patterns that should be incorporated into a rehabilitation & training routine: Push Pull Hinge Squat Lunge Core Carry If you’re not instilling these patterns into your ro...

S4:E7 - My intake to exercise machines vs free weight equipment 09.05.2022

- FREE WEIGHT EQUIPMENT: Helps us learn motor control capabilities & imbalances between right / left sides You have more control & the ability to really focus on full ranges of motion about a joint or body part More transferable / versatile to real-life movements patterns / capabilities . .
